Intended Use / Indications for Use
The truSculpt iD device is intended to generate heat within body tissues for the treatment of selected medical conditions, such as the relief of minor aches, pain, and muscle spasms; an increase in local circulation; a reduction in circumference of the abdomen; and non-invasive lipolysis (breakdown of fat) of the abdomen. The truGlide roller is intended to provide temporary reduction in the appearance of cellulite.
The truSculpt RF energy is intended to provide topical heating for the purpose of elevating tissue temperature for the treatment of selected medical conditions, such as relief of pain and muscle spasms and increase in local circulation. Additionally, the 2MHz setting for the 40 cm² handpiece is indicated for reduction in circumference of the abdomen and non-invasive lipolysis (breakdown of fat) of the abdomen. The truSculpt massage device is intended to provide a temporary reduction in the appearance of cellulite.

Device Description
The truSculpt iD device consists of a console, one or more RF handpieces that connect to the console with umbilical cables, and a truGlide massage roller. All system functions are controlled through the console. The handpieces deliver RF energy to generate a heating profile that produces a moderate temperature rise in the subcutaneous tissue, while monitoring epidermal temperature. The truGlide is a separate mechanical roller that can be used as a massager.

Summary of Performance Studies (study type, sample size, AUC, MRMC, standalone performance, key results)
• Skin temperature testing on 3 human subjects to demonstrate that the 2 cm² RF applicator can maintain therapeutic temperatures of 40°-45°C on the skin surface and that skin temperatures do not exceed 45°C during the course of the treatment
• Software verification and validation testing
Performance data demonstrates that any differences between the modified and existing truSculpt iD devices do not raise new safety or effectiveness questions. Skin temperature testing with the 2 cm2 RF applicator on three human subjects further demonstrates that the modified truSculpt iD device can maintain therapeutic temperatures of 40°-45°C on the skin surface and that maximum skin temperatures do not exceed 45°C.
The addition of the 2 cm² RF applicator only impacts the relief of pain and muscle spasms and increase in local circulation indications. The reduction in circumference and lipolysis indications are achieved through the use of the 2 MHz setting for the 40 cm2 handpiece, and the cellulite indication is achieved through the use of the truSculpt massage device.

§ 878.4400 Electrosurgical cutting and coagulation device and accessories.
(a)
Identification. An electrosurgical cutting and coagulation device and accessories is a device intended to remove tissue and control bleeding by use of high-frequency electrical current.(b)
Classification. Class II.

Conclusion: The modified truSculpt iD device has equivalent technological characteristics and principles of operation as the existing truSculpt iD device (K221407). Cutera performed a detailed risk analysis of the modified device to assess the impact of the changes, and no new risks were identified.
Performance data demonstrates that any differences between the modified and existing truSculpt iD devices do not raise new safety or effectiveness questions. Skin temperature testing with the 2 cm2 RF applicator on three human subjects further demonstrates that the modified truSculpt iD device can maintain therapeutic temperatures of 40°-45°C on the skin surface and that maximum skin temperatures do not exceed 45°C.
The addition of the 2 cm² RF applicator only impacts the relief of pain and muscle spasms and increase in local circulation indications. The reduction in circumference and lipolysis indications are achieved through the use of the 2 MHz setting for the 40 cm2 handpiece, and the cellulite indication is achieved through the use of the truSculpt massage device.
The modified truSculpt iD device is substantially equivalent to the existing truSculpt iD device.
